Senior Software Engineer/ Principal Software Engineer - Copilot CLI

Microsoft

Quick summary

Work type
On-site
Location
Redmond, WA
Salary
$119,800–$234,700 / yr
Posted
25 days ago
Closes
Nov 29, 2026

Market check

Salary context

Competitive pay

How this pay compares to similar roles

Similar $192k
This role $177k
$106k most similar roles pay here $248k

This role pays more than 51% of similar roles. Most pay $167,100–$217,725 — the shaded band above. At the midpoint, this role pays about $177k versus about $192k for comparable roles.

Based on 240 similar postings.

Employer

About Microsoft

Microsoft Corporation is a global technology leader producing software, hardware, and cloud services including Windows, Office 365, Azure cloud platform, Xbox gaming, and Surface devices. Industry: Software & Cloud Computing

Microsoft currently has 622 open roles on FindRole.

Listed pay typically runs $119,800–$234,700 across 559 roles with salary data.

Most-posted roles

View all roles at Microsoft

At a glance

TL;DR · Senior Software Engineer/ Principal Software Engineer - Copilot CLI

As a Senior Software Engineer on the Copilot CLI team, you will take ownership of critical product areas and set high technical standards for agentic systems and developer tools. Your day-to-day responsibilities include designing performant terminal experiences, iterating based on data and user feedback, and collaborating with cross-functional teams to build scalable agentic products. You should have hands-on experience in languages like C++, Java, or Python, and a strong background in building and operating generative AI systems. Additionally, you will influence architecture decisions and engineering standards beyond your immediate team, requiring solid engineering fundamentals and expertise in system design and performance optimization. Experience with terminal UIs and low-level primitives is beneficial, as is contributing to open-source projects at scale.

What you'll do

  • Build and evaluate agentic systems, focusing on tool design and quality optimization.
  • Design high-performance terminal experiences that are fast and reliable for daily use.
  • Take ownership of critical product areas in the Copilot CLI and shared agent runtime.
  • Use data and user feedback to guide iterative improvements in agentic systems.
  • Influence architecture and engineering standards beyond your immediate team’s scope.

What we're looking for

  • Bachelor's Degree in Computer Science or related field and 6+ years of technical engineering experience.
  • Hands-on experience building and operating generative AI or agentic systems in production.
  • Strong product mindset with proven ability to drive ambiguous problem spaces to high-quality outcomes.
  • Solid engineering fundamentals, including systems design, performance optimization, and debugging in complex environments.
  • Experience designing, running, and optimizing evaluations for agentic systems, including tools and agent loops.
  • Deep experience building customer-facing developer products, spanning platform foundations and user experiences.

More like this

Similar roles

Senior Software Engineer

Microsoft

Redmond, WA 148 days ago $119,800$234,700
Chromium C++ JavaScript HTML CSS WebAssembly Git CI/CD W3C Docker Linux Windows MacOS Cross-platform Debugging PerformanceOptimization RenderingPipeline BrowserEngine WebDevelopmentTools REST_APIs
Hybrid

Senior Software Engineer

Warner Bros. Discovery

Remote 13 days ago
Python Go Java C++ PostgreSQL DynamoDB Terraform LLMs prompt engineering evaluation frameworks A/B testing methodologies CI/CD Kubernetes AWS Git Docker
Remote

Senior Software Engineer

The Walt Disney Company

Remote 51 days ago $148,700$199,400
Java AWS DynamoDB SQS RDS Kinesis SQL NoSQL CI/CD Python PostgreSQL Kubernetes Terraform Git Docker Prometheus Grafana
Remote

Senior Software Engineer

Microsoft

Houston, TX 4 days ago $119,800$234,700
Python Java JavaScript C C++ ROS2 ABB RDK FANUC UR Isaac Sim Omniverse AI OPC UA MQTT

Senior Software Engineer

Oracle

Nashville, TN 32 days ago $99,600$223,400
Oracle Cloud Infrastructure PostgreSQL JavaScript TypeScript CI/CD Oracle Database Java Oracle APEX SQL Docker Kubernetes Terraform Python Go

Senior Software Engineer

Apple Inc

Cupertino, CA 29 days ago $181,100$272,100
Python APIs Docker Kubernetes CI/CD LLMs GenAI APIs Prometheus Grafana AWS Azure Google Cloud Platform PostgreSQL MongoDB Redis Terraform Ansible Git Jenkins GitHub Bitbucket Slack Confluence Jira SaaS platforms Workflow orchestration systems Enterprise automation platforms